Conditions

Glucocorticoid induced hyperglycemia High blood glucose caused by anti-inflammatory medication

Interventions

Subjects will be consecutively treated by (A) NPH insulin once daily and by (B) short acting insulin in a sliding scale regimen. The order of the treatment regimens will be determined by randomizati

Inclusion criteria

Inclusion criteria: - Glucocorticoid induced hyperglycemia in previous cycle of chemotherapy that required therapy initiation or adjustment - Duration of glucocorticoid cycles 4-10 consecutive days and * 4 glucocorticoid-free days between 2 cycles - Age * 18 years & written informed consent - Prednisone-equivalent dose of * 12,5mg - At least 2 more cycles of chemotherapy to receive

Exclusion criteria

Exclusion criteria: history of hypo-unawareness, continuous tube or parental feeding, continuous (maintenance) systemic glucocorticoid therapy

Design outcomes

Primary

MeasureTime frame
For each subject, we calculate the fraction of glucose measurements within target range during a chemotherapy cycle (a continuous variable). The mean difference of this fraction between treatment cycles is the outcome variable.

Secondary

MeasureTime frame
Regarding glycemic control: o Difference in average daily blood glucose after 24h of treatment o Difference of proportion of subjects within target range in each treatment condition o Difference in average number of blood glucose measurements per treatment day o Difference in average insulin daily dose per treatment day o Difference in proportion of measurements above and lower than target range o Incidence of severe hypoglycemia Treatment satisfaction: patient preference for treatment regimen in third chemotherapy cycle Clinical outcomes: incidence of common (hyperglycemia related) chemotoxicity o Incidence of oral candidiasis o Pooled incidence of all G3-4 chemotoxicity
